本文分析了当框架上下梁带集中质量时的线性平面微振动,综合考虑了横向与纵向振动两个方面;又以拐角的位移连续和力平衡条件,推得了整体框架在弹簧支承下的频率方程的解析式,还导出了整体框架的动力响应的解析式,並应用电算计算,其结果与实测亦能很好吻合。同时文中还讨论了剪切变形与旋转惯量的效应,並给出了计算曲线图表,引出了本方程适用条件。
